Tasting Room: Buena Vista Winery
Tasting Room: Buena Vista Winery
Architectural Plastics, Inc.Architectural Plastics, Inc.
The prolific vintner Jean-Charles Boisset owns several wineries throughout the world; about half a dozen of them in the Napa and Sonoma counties. His unique style and attention to detail have made his wineries and tasting rooms some of the most frequented in California’s wine country. Architectural Plastics has worked with Boisset to design and create bespoke pieces for several of his Northern California locations. This ongoing partnership has been a personal favorite of the Architectural Plastics design and fabrication team. These acrylic tasting tables are made using thick gauges of clear acrylic, polished and glued together. The tops are hollow and secret openings allow them to be stuffed with gold foil and jewelry for the visitors to enjoy.

La Jolla / Del Mar Large Custom Wine Cellar Walk In with Tasting Table and Glass
La Jolla / Del Mar Large Custom Wine Cellar Walk In with Tasting Table and Glass
Vintage CellarsVintage Cellars
Welcome to your new favorite spot in the house! With this showpiece Custom Wine Cellar, why would you ever have a party anywhere else? Complete with an adjacent room with a large tasting table and space to entertain, this homeowner thought of it all! This unique Custom wine room in a gorgeous neighborhood in the La Jolla and Del Mar region in sunny San Diego, California is an art piece in itself surrounded by even more art pieces. The Wine Room Construction entailed unique custom fitted racking, tiering down from about ten feet on one end of the room to just below eight feet on the other. Producing high quality wine racking for a cellar like this is no easy feat, but that is exactly what the wine cellar builders and team at vintage cellars do best! The glass front and custom wine cellar door, highlighted with metal framing in an interesting checkered pattern throughout, also posed a unique challenge within this wine cellar space. Glass walls, although absolutely stunning, can reduce the cooling capabilities within the wine room itself- simply due to the non insulating properties of glass. Whenever glass is utilized within a custom wine cellar, we always make sure to install dual paned thermal insulated glass. Within the wine cellar itself, The racking is made of all heart redwood with a clear finish, with single deep individual bottle storage above a high reveal display row and double deep bottle storage below. The amount of custom and unique features in this gorgeous custom wine cellar in La Jolla are almost too numerous to count! Take a closer peek and you will notice that the walls are covered with a custom redwood paneling with custom moldings throughout. The interestingly shaped island also has room for large format bottle storage and a small chilled wine refrigerator specifically for whites ready to be served. Diamond bins are also in a hidden back corner not pictured. Custom wine cellar with a glass fronts have become fixtures in gorgeous homes throughout California. Underground wine cellar in East Sussex using pine wood with an oak stain
Underground wine cellar in East Sussex using pine wood with an oak stain
Wineware Racks and Accessories LtdWineware Racks and Accessories Ltd
Large underground wine cellar for a private home in East Sussex, UK. The wine room is filled with a combination of individual bottle racking, display racks, storage cubes, work surfaces and slide out shelves for case racks, all of which are made from solid pine with an oak. The wine room in total can store over 1000 bottles.
